    Bryant furnace to a Hunter programmable thermostat
    I am trying to hook up a programmable hunter thermostat model # 44360 to a bryant system and heat pump, I have 6 wires coming out of the wall one green, red, orange, blue, yellow and white, the hunter thermostatha g, rc, rh, y/o, w/b, and y1 can any body tell me what goes where?

    You might have the wrong thermostat. You need a W2 location for your 2nd stage heat. Y0 and Y2 I believe is for 2 stage cooling.
